Property description

Main description ***freehold & no vendor chain***Stepping Stones are delighted to offer for sale this beautiful stone cottage situated just a short distance from Glossop town centre and stunning open countryside.

Nestled between Sheffield and Manchester on the edge of the breath-taking Peak District National Park, Glossop offers a host of local shopping and leisure facilities, including a good selection of shops, restaurants, and pubs with home-cooked food, together with a direct rail link into Manchester City Centre. It is within proximity to numerous doorstep scenic walks, breath-taking open countryside, and has the additional leisure pursuits of a leisure centre, swimming pool, sports clubs, tennis courts and an 18-hole golf course.

This lovely home has been very well-maintained throughout, and is a fine example of a 'turn-key' home, with the option to keep the existing furniture. The property has full planning permission for a ground floor extension*, with plans available upon request.

The internal accommodation in brief comprises: Lounge, Kitchen and Conservatory to the ground floor, Two Bedrooms and Bathroom to the first floor and a generous-sized Loft Room to the second floor.

Externally to the front of the property is a pretty, walled and gated forecourt garden. Whilst to the rear, there is a Garage and Two Parking Spaces, a Stone Outbuilding and a Woodland Aspect.

Lounge 12' 8" x 12' 9" (3.86m x 3.89m) uPVC double glazed external door to lounge, feature beams to ceiling, ceiling light point, two wall light points, feature fireplace with gas pebble-effect fire, TV aerial point, wall-mounted radiator, internal door to kitchen and u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ation.

Kitchen/breakfast room 12' 9" x 10' 2" (3.89m x 3.1m) A range of high and low fitted kitchen units with contrasting work-surface, splash-back tiling, integrated electric oven and four ring gas hob with over-hob extractor fan, stainless steel sink and drainer unit with mixer tap, plumbing for slimline dishwasher and washing machine, under counter fridge and freezer, wall mounted radiator, ceiling light point, under-stairs storage cupboard, stairs to the first floor accommodation, uPVC double glazed door and window to the conservatory.

Conservatory 8' 1" x 7' 6" (2.46m x 2.29m) uPVC double glazed conservatory to the rear elevation, ceiling light point and power points.

Landing Stairs from the ground to the first floor, ceiling light point, internal doors to the first floor accommodation and stairs to the loft room.

Main bedroom 12' 9" x 10' 2" (3.89m x 3.1m) A generous double bedroom with fitted wardrobes, wall-mounted radiator, three wall light points, ceiling light point and u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ation.

Bedroom two 7' 4" x 6' 3" (2.24m x 1.91m) With wall-mounted radiator, wall-mounted Worcester combination boiler, ceiling light point and u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ation with woodland aspect.

Bathroom 6' 4" x 5' 1" (1.93m x 1.55m) A three-piece suite comprising a low-level W/C, pedestal sink unit and bath with over-bath shower, splash-back tiling, ceiling spotlights and u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ation.

Loft room 14' 5" x 12' 7" (4.39m x 3.84m) A generous loft room with Velux window to the rear elevation, two wall-mounted radiators, power points, storage to eaves, and ceiling light points.

External To the front there is a pretty, walled and gated forecourt garden.
To the rear there is a garage and two parking spaces, a stone outbuilding & woodland aspect.
